CoStar Shares Outstanding 2010-2024 | CSGP

CoStar shares outstanding history from 2010 to 2024. Shares outstanding can be defined as the number of shares held by shareholders (including insiders) assuming conversion of all convertible debt, securities, warrants and options. This metric excludes the company's treasury shares.
  • CoStar shares outstanding for the quarter ending December 31, 2024 were 0.408B, a 0.22% increase year-over-year.
  • CoStar 2024 shares outstanding were 0.408B, a 0.22% increase from 2023.
  • CoStar 2023 shares outstanding were 0.407B, a 2.29% increase from 2022.
  • CoStar 2022 shares outstanding were 0.398B, a 0.91% increase from 2021.

CoStar Group, Inc. provides information services to the commercial real estate industry. Their wide array of digital service offerings includes a leasing marketplace, a selling marketplace, sales comparable information, decision support, contact management, tenant information, property marketing, and industry news. They have three assets that provide a unique foundation for this marketplace: comprehensive national databases; large research department; and large number of participating organizations.
